MCX Shares Surge on Weaker Dollar, Regulatory Easing
MCX shares surged 8% in three days to Rs 3,211 as gold and silver futures rose amid a weaker US dollar and easing concerns over long-term yields.
The stock has gained 15% in a month, 45% so far this year, and 101% over the past year. It delivered a staggering 932% return in three years and 970% in five years.
Domestically, MCX silver futures for September 2026 delivery jumped Rs 1,915 to Rs 2,45,158 per kg, while gold futures for October 2026 delivery rose by Rs 1,205 to Rs 1,60,630 per 10 grams. The U.S. dollar was headed for a weekly decline, making dollar-priced commodities more affordable.
HDFC Securities recently reaffirmed its 'Buy' rating on MCX shares, citing regulatory easing that could expand the participant base and broaden product offerings.
